The Cellar Door restaurant's executive chef Greg Lutes has an amazingly large talent for a small town outside Yosemite National Park. Groveland, California, is a gold rush era town with about 1,500 residents. It is not exactly the place one would expect to find impeccable cuisine, but Chef Greg's list of foodie fans continues to grow from the California and the Bay Area to the UK.
